Output 8872268ca87798be380d2030bb236bc54f63d879632103cec3f68df71d0ef682:103

value
84454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f7ab93907fd89e2d2e86a1a4c043c10678d9d0b OP_EQUALVERIFY OP_CHECKSIG
address
16neb4o62Kr2rHa4gMZWBcMRr2bLhwX829
transaction
8872268ca87798be380d2030bb236bc54f63d879632103cec3f68df71d0ef682